1) Division by zero (CVE-ID: CVE-2026-46161)
CWE-ID: CWE-369 - Divide By Zero
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:L/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a local user to cause a denial of service.
The vulnerability exists due to divide-by-zero in setup_geo() when processing a user-provided layout parameter with zero far_copies and the improved far set layout selected. A local user can supply a crafted layout value to cause a denial of service.
The issue is triggered when far_copies is zero under the improved far set layout.
